Summoners Ensemble Theatre presents John Kevin Jones in his solo performance of A Christmas Carol directed by Dr. Rhonda Dodd. A Christmas Carol will play four performances only tonight, December 12-15 at The Studio Theatre in Theatre Row (410 West 42nd Street).

Starting with Dickens' own performing version of A Christmas Carol, John Kevin Jones and Rhonda Dodd have crafted a work of storytelling that highlights Dickens' beautiful imagery and wry humor. Summoners Ensemble brings A Christmas Carol's ghosts, graveyards, goodness and redemption to life with one actor and over 15 characters. A performance and story that is sure to resonate with you and your family long after this holiday season is past.

John Kevin Jones: Kevin is a member of Actors' Equity, The Dramatist Guild of America and is an Artistic Associate of Summoners Ensemble Theatre. New York credits include Jeffrey (opposite Bryan Batt) at Lincoln Center, The Winter's Tale and The Caucasian Chalk Circle both with the Hipgnosis Theatre Company. Regional: American Stage in St. Pete, Florida (The Pavilion), Arkansas Rep. (Othello), Kentucky Rep. (The Rivals, All My Sons, Comedy of Errors), Playhouse on the Square in Memphis, Tennessee (Angels in America, Last Night of Ballyhoo, Gross Indecency). Directing credits include A Lie Of The Mind at Theatre Memphis, Revenge of the Space Pandas at Texas Shakespeare Festival and Rogers and Hammerstein's Cinderella at Playhouse on the Square.

Rhonda Dodd: Rhonda is the Artistic Director of Summoners Ensemble Theatre. On, above and behind the boards, Rhonda is an award winning actor, technician and director. Arriving in New York with over 150 shows under her belt, she made her Off-Broadway acting debut in 1994 with Terese Hayden's Workshop in Tennessee Williams' Period of Adjustment. Since that time, besides finishing her Ph.D., she has worked both as an actor and director as part of the New York Independent Theatre scene. For almost ten years as Associate Director of Circle in the Square Theatre School Dr. Dodd helped young actors at the beginning of their careers both with advice and acting expertise. Still acting in and around New York, Rhonda has also worked regionally including shows with the New Harmony Theater in Indiana and the Hamptons Shakespeare Festival.
